I made this drip zebra design back in september for people who wanted an animal print with attitude, not the usual plain zebra stripes, but something that looked like the stripes were literally dripping colour. Five colours: the base black stripes, the white or cream stripe gaps, and three drip tones which I kept as vivid contrasting hues so ya get that graffiti-style pop against the animal pattern. Nine sizes run from 3.25 inches wide at the smallest up to 6.97 inches wide and 7.5 inches tall, stitch count going from 9,556 on the small end up to 25,756 on the large.

Density at 493 is on the lower end and that was deliberate, the drip sections have long narrow satin columns running vertically and overly dense fill in those sections causes column buckling on knit fabrics. Lower density means they lay flat on a cotton jersey hoodie without pulling the fabric sideways. Pair light cutaway stretch fabrics and a firm tearaway on woven canvas or denim. The drip tips at the bottom of the design are the finest detail points, slow the machine down for em or youll get fraying at the ends of the satin columns.

White or cream base fabric is the most obvious call here, it lets all five colours read as intended. Black base fabric can work really well too if ya swap the white stripe thread to a light grey or silver, the colour drips still pop against dark backgrounds and the effect looks more dramatic and street-art-style. Avoid mid-tone fabrics like charcoal or olive, there isnt enough contrast for the design to read cleanly. Pair with an Africa-themed or safari collection if you're building a range, the contrast between this bold drip style and a classic realistic animal portrait is really nice for a shop lineup.

What people are using this design for

A starting point. The design works for plenty more than just this list, this is what folks have stitched it onto most.

  • Bold streetwear hoodie chest designStitch the 5-in motif on white or black cotton hoodie chest using firm cutaway, slow the machine at the drip tips.
  • Fashion-forward tote bag front panelUse the 5-inch piece placed on a canvas tote front panel, white or black base lets the five colours show at their best.
  • Pop-art themed bedroom cushion coverthe 4 in piece on a white cotton cushion cover looks bold and modern, cutaway backing for the knit cover fabric.
  • Safari-inspired kids room wall hoopUse the small 4-in on cream cotton muslin in a hoop for framed wall art, tearaway or cutaway depending on fabric weight.
  • Festival or event custom merchandiseThe 5-in motif on white cotton tee works well for festival or event merch, tearaway on pre-shrunk woven cotton.
  • Art-style patches for denim jacketsThe 3.25-inch size on a denim patch with firm cutaway, stitch first then heat-apply or sew the patch onto the jacket.
  • Bold gym bag embroidered side panelStitch the small 4-in on a black canvas gym bag side panel, cutaway stabiliser on the flat woven base fabric.
